Roasted corn brings added sweetness to this delicious chowder. Made creamy by pureeing part of the mix and paired with tomato and blue cheese for tartness, this soup is a treat.

Ingredients

  • 3 red bell peppers, halved and seeded
  • 3 ears shucked corn
  • 1½ lbs. tomatoes, halved, seeded, and peeled (about 4)
  • 2 Tbsp. extra-virgin olive oil
  • 4 cups chopped onion (about 2 medium)
  • 3 (14 oz.) cans fat-free, low sodium vegetable broth
  • ¼ tsp. salt
  • ¼ tsp. freshly ground black pepper
  • ¼ cup (1 oz.) crumbled blue cheese
  • 2 Tbsp. chopped fresh chives

Directions

  1. Prepare grill to medium-high heat.
  2. Arrange bell peppers, skin side down, and corn in a single layer on a grill rack; grill turning corn occasionally (5 minutes).
  3. Add tomatoes and grill until vegetables are slightly charred (5 minutes). Remove from heat; cool. Coarsely chop tomatoes and bell peppers; place in a medium bowl. Cut kernels from ears of corn; add to tomato mixture.
  4. Heat oil in a large Dutch oven over medium heat. Add onion; cook until tender, stirring occasionally (7 minutes).
  5. Stir in tomato mixture; stirring occasionally (3 minutes).
  6. Increase heat to high, and stir in broth. Bring to a boil. Reduce heat, and simmer until vegetables are tender (30 minutes). Cool 20 minutes.
  7. Place one-third of tomato mixture in a blender; process until smooth. Place pureed mixture in a large bowl. Repeat procedure twice with remaining tomato mixture.
  8. Wipe pan clean with paper towels. Press tomato mixture through a sieve into pan; discard solids. Place pan over medium heat; cook until thoroughly heated.
  9. Stir in salt and black pepper. Ladle about 1 1/2 cups soup into each of 6 bowls; top each serving with 2 teaspoons cheese and 1 teaspoon chives.
Nutritional analysis per serving: Calories 195; Total Fat 7g (9% Daily Value); Saturated Fat 2g (10% DV); Trans Fat 0g; Cholesterol 4mg (2% DV); Sodium 280mg (12% DV); Total Carbohydrate 30g (11% DV); Dietary Fiber 6.5g (21% DV); Total Sugars 14g; Includes 0g Added Sugars (0% DV); Protein 6g; Vitamin D 0% DV; Calcium 6% DV; Iron 6% DV; Potassium 15% DV; Vitamin C 110% DV; Molybdenum 40% DV; Biotin 25% DV.
